What will happen to the sun on the Day of Judgment?

A. It will rise from the west
B. It will fall into the ocean
C. It will remain stationary
D. It will disappear

Answer: It will rise from the west


Additional Information: One of the major signs of the Day of Judgment is the sun rising from the west instead of the east.
